Orange County EDC Launches Shop Local Campaign
The Orange County Economic Development Corporation, with the help of Dow Chemical has launched a Shop Local Campaign for all of Orange County. They plan to publish Shop Local Orange County that residents will see while doing their online shopping. For more information, visit their Facebook page.

Orange Fire Department Purchases New Truck
February 20, 2020
The City of Orange Fire Department traveled to Appleton, Wisconsin, in early February to pick up a 2019 Pierce 2000 GPM Pumper. This truck will be replacing a 2000 model Quality Pumper. Orange Lions City Park Closed Indefinitely
February 19, 2020
Due to safety concerns, Orange Lions City Park has been closed until further notice. A recent inspection found the playground equipment at the park to be structurally unsafe for continued use.
